Transaction 663c3c659c8c67fc27e414bc6d78f394f53b2a15851b1278511835ecad01e813
1 Input
1 Output
-
663c3c659c8c67fc27e414bc6d78f394f53b2a15851b1278511835ecad01e813:0
- value
- 331787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aab12d003608375727971a5b2182e3d9169dc5d OP_EQUAL
- address
- 38Vps8h7jANSW3JerwpFdazpjAXkWnFkFp